Transaction 8429fd4576535f811ac7dbdc99f8d7bb38350bcb9e8da82f96eed99afc522b33

1 Input
2 Outputs
  • 8429fd4576535f811ac7dbdc99f8d7bb38350bcb9e8da82f96eed99afc522b33:0
  • value  2261403
    address  145MscfCaDVWGDh5R17Zb8rZc3h5sPNwaH
  • 8429fd4576535f811ac7dbdc99f8d7bb38350bcb9e8da82f96eed99afc522b33:1
  • value  638258228
    address  38ZuCDSMqzYddgPymGnd5Xp2RVw3KbxK3g